Based on material control at the atomic and molecular level, this department focuses on the creation, application, and development of new materials that can support a sustainable society. The focus is on comprehensively understanding functions manifested from materials and considering free thinking and activity to develop materials in an unexplored region. In other words, the aim is to develop researchers and scientists/engineers who can discover new materials and functions with basic analytical capacity, who can solve problems logically, and who can develop new materials with flexible ideas. In the latter half of the doctoral course, researchers and technologists aim to develop new materials based on wider visual fields and advanced specialized knowledge and transmit cutting-edge and original ideas at an international level.
